London’s mayor is totally against a northern England bid.
The mayor of London, England is unhappy because cities in northern England want to band together and bid for the 2040 Summer Olympics. The English government’s proposal to bring the Olympic and Paralympic Games to northern England during the 2040s is set to enter its preliminary assessment stage. “London 2012 showed what the Olympics can do for our country. It inspired a generation through sport, attracted huge investment and showed the best of Britain to the world,” said Lisa Nandy, England’s Culture Secretary. There has never been a real financial assessment of the 2012 London Summer Olympics or proof the huge investment actually paid off. Historically, the Olympics is a money loser.
London Mayor Sadiq Khan is unhappy with the government’s plan. Khan said excluding his city would be “a missed opportunity”. Khan’s spokesperson didn’t mince any words. “Sadiq believes that a potential country-wide bid, using all the assets we have in the UK, including the publicly-owned London Stadium would deliver the very best possible Olympics. Using London’s existing world-class infrastructure would help deliver the greenest and most sustainable Games, as well as unlocking huge economic growth both here in London and around the country. Not including the capital in an Olympics bid would be a missed opportunity, and mean our country fails to unleash the full benefits of a UK-wide games.” Nandy disagreed. “But while the north of England has driven so much sporting excellence, no matter the talent we produce, the sporting moments we create and the world-class events we attract for too long we have been told the Olympics is simply too big and too important to be hosted in the north. Not anymore. It’s time the Olympics came north and we showed what we can offer to the world.” The International Olympic Committee doesn’t mind the English squabble.
